#094e59 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#094e59 is composed of 3.5% red, 30.6%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.9% cyan, 12.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 65.1% black. It has a hue angle of 188.3 degrees, a saturation of 81.6% and a lightness of 19.2%. #094e59 color hex could be obtained by blending #129cb2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#094e59 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#094e59 has RGB values of R:9, G:78,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.12, Y:0,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 609881.
